Key Responsibilities :
- Client Communication : Call clients bi-weekly to check in on treatment progression, loop in case managers on treatment issues, send emails to clients for non-compliance, and update communications tracker with a summary of all client communications.
- Scheduling : Arrange the initial client medical appointment and find the client a chiropractor. Ensure providers are convenient for the client and that all appointments are timely scheduled by providers. Further, arrange for transportation through the provider if the client does not have a vehicle at the moment.
- Record Keeping & Tracking : Request medical and billing records (with and without affidavits). Update internal treatment trackers. Double-check affidavits for accuracy and requirements (signature / notary stamp / etc.)
- Medical Email Management : Oversee dedicated medical inbox; respond to inquiries, sort medical emails in appropriate client folders, promptly save records as they come in.
- Billing & Treatment Coordination : Send LOPs (Letters of Protection), manage approvals for treatment with case managers, and work closely with providers to resolve issues.
- Case Management Updates : Keep case managers informed about clients’ treatment progression; notify them of non-compliance or scheduling conflicts and communicate about issues / concerns.
- Document Management : Scan, organize, and store medical records accurately and uniformly.
- Phone Coverage : Receive and transfer calls professionally and direct calls to the appropriate team members.
